What is a Unity developer?

Unity Developers are professionals who use the Unity game engine to create interactive experiences, such as video games, simulations, and virtual or augmented reality applications. They write code, often in C#, to bring game mechanics, graphics, and user interfaces to life. Unity Developers collaborate with designers, artists, and other team members to build and optimize applications for various platforms, including mobile devices, consoles, and PCs. Their role involves both technical programming and creative problem-solving to ensure high-quality, engaging user experiences.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Unity develop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Unity Developer, you need strong proficiency in C# programming, a solid understanding of game development principles, and experience with the Unity engine, often sup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with source control systems (like Git), versioning tools, and Unity-specific features such as the Asset Store and Unity Analytics is typically required. Creativity, problem-solving skills, and effective communication help developers collaborate with multidisciplinary teams and address complex challenges. These abilities are crucial for delivering polished, high-performing interactive experiences and meeting project goals in a competitive industry.

What are some common challenges Unity developers face when working on large-scale projects?

Unity Developers working on large-scale projects often encounter challenges such as optimizing game performance, managing complex codebases, and ensuring smooth collaboration between team members. Performance bottlenecks can arise from handling large assets or complex scenes, requiring careful profiling and optimization. Additionally, maintaining clean and modular code is crucial as multiple developers contribute to the same project, making version control and clear documentation essential. Regular communication with designers, artists, and other developers helps to align project goals and resolve issues quickly.
